summary refs log tree commit diff
path: root/pkgs/applications/misc/oneko/default.nix
diff options
context:
space:
mode:
authorMatthew Bauer <mjbauer95@gmail.com>2018-11-27 19:54:15 -0600
committerMatthew Bauer <mjbauer95@gmail.com>2018-11-28 20:14:33 -0600
commita858113076b9012664237eb619b9289936b187a9 (patch)
tree4e29768520a82831c83dbeffc7a34b03a1e6a66f /pkgs/applications/misc/oneko/default.nix
parent613e262fc2f84d068da40ee6c45f0915c00e2193 (diff)
downloadnixpkgs-a858113076b9012664237eb619b9289936b187a9.tar
nixpkgs-a858113076b9012664237eb619b9289936b187a9.tar.gz
nixpkgs-a858113076b9012664237eb619b9289936b187a9.tar.bz2
nixpkgs-a858113076b9012664237eb619b9289936b187a9.tar.lz
nixpkgs-a858113076b9012664237eb619b9289936b187a9.tar.xz
nixpkgs-a858113076b9012664237eb619b9289936b187a9.tar.zst
nixpkgs-a858113076b9012664237eb619b9289936b187a9.zip
oneko: use imake setup hook
Simplifies some things here.
Diffstat (limited to 'pkgs/applications/misc/oneko/default.nix')
-rw-r--r--pkgs/applications/misc/oneko/default.nix13
1 files changed, 5 insertions, 8 deletions
diff --git a/pkgs/applications/misc/oneko/default.nix b/pkgs/applications/misc/oneko/default.nix
index e1cc70e4277..311f093ba6d 100644
--- a/pkgs/applications/misc/oneko/default.nix
+++ b/pkgs/applications/misc/oneko/default.nix
@@ -1,4 +1,4 @@
-{ stdenv, fetchurl, xorg, xlibsWrapper }:
+{ stdenv, fetchurl, imake, gccmakedep, xlibsWrapper }:
 
 stdenv.mkDerivation rec {
   version = "1.2.sakura.5";
@@ -8,14 +8,11 @@ stdenv.mkDerivation rec {
     url = "http://www.daidouji.com/oneko/distfiles/oneko-${version}.tar.gz";
     sha256 = "2c2e05f1241e9b76f54475b5577cd4fb6670de058218d04a741a04ebd4a2b22f";
   };
-  buildInputs = [ xorg.imake xorg.gccmakedep xlibsWrapper ];
+  nativeBuildInputs = [ imake gccmakedep ];
+  buildInputs = [ xlibsWrapper ];
 
-  configurePhase = "xmkmf";
-
-  installPhase = ''
-    make install BINDIR=$out/bin
-    make install.man MANPATH=$out/share/man
-  '';
+  makeFlags = [ "BINDIR=$(out)/bin" "MANPATH=$(out)/share/man" ];
+  installTargets = "install install.man";
 
   meta = with stdenv.lib; {
     description = "Creates a cute cat chasing around your mouse cursor";